The Hunger Games cupcakes: by Fictional Food: matching the birds of Mockingjay perfectly
Calling all The Hunger Games fans: you will definitely want to check out these Mockingjay (Book 3 in the trilogy) cupcakes by blogger Fictional Food, who very carefully matched the birds on the book covers with edible cupcake toppers made of black fondant and edible gold glaze. Gorgeous! They were recently featured on ABC's Nightline.

Neil Gaiman Sandman character cupcakes Death, Dream and Delirium with custom macaron toppers!
By Montreal, Quebec custom cupcake maker Cupcake et Macaron (via Twitter), cupcakes inspired by popular author Neil Gaiman and his graphic novel series The Sandman! (Read more about it here.) Specifically, Little Endless macarons on cupcakes. Find out more about Cupcake et Macaron on Facebook.

See more in this blog post, with this explanation (see more photos there too):
See more in this blog post, with this explanation (see more photos there too):
This is pure self-indulgence. The first time that I read Neil Gaiman's Sandman (I've read it many, many more times since) was one of those experiences that I just knew somehow changed me. You don't often read stories that are so well written, and with such lovely characters. I just adored it, and if you haven't read it yet, you really, really should! With that in mind, it really was just a matter of time before my love for Sandman met my love of everything sweet and delicious! I will eventually do all seven siblings as fondant figures, but for now, I made my favourites: Death, Dream and of course, Delirium!
